The Delta 28-560 2W is a 16-inch two-wheel combo bandsaw for wood and light metal cutting. A close variant of the Delta 28-540, it offers dual-speed operation, a tilting table, and trusted Delta durability—ideal for maintenance shops, small fabricators, and serious hobbyists.
Dual-Purpose Wood & Metal Cutting
Designed for wood, plastics, and light metal cutting
Dual-speed operation allows material-specific cutting
Ideal for workshops needing one versatile machine
Two-Wheel Bandsaw Design
Traditional 2-wheel vertical bandsaw layout
Provides stable blade tracking and consistent cutting accuracy
Simple and proven mechanical design
Blade Compatibility & Flexibility
Uses 142-inch continuous bandsaw blades
Supports blade widths from 0.125 inch to 1 inch
Compatible with multiple TPI options for different materials
Dual-Speed Drive System
Speed change achieved via belt and pulley adjustments
Fast speed for wood cutting, slower speed for metal cutting
Enhances blade life and surface finish
Cast-Iron Tilting Table
Heavy-duty cast-iron table reduces vibration
Table tilts up to 45° in both directions for bevel cuts
Provides excellent support for larger workpieces
Efficient Motor Performance
Typically equipped with a 0.5 HP motor running at 1725 RPM
Smooth power delivery for light-duty applications
Energy-efficient for continuous workshop use
Upgrade-Friendly Construction
Commonly upgraded with urethane tires for improved tracking
Compatible with aftermarket belts and accessories
Easy maintenance and blade replacement

| Blade Length inches | 142" |
| Min/Max Blade Width | 1/8" to 1" |
| Machine Type | Combo |
| Configuration | 2-Wheel Vertical |
| Saw Size | 16 inch |
| Motor Power | 0.5 HP |
| Motor Speed | 1725 RPM |
| Speed Control | Dual-speed via belt/pulley |
| Table Material | Cast Iron |
| Table Tilt | Up to 45° both directions |
| Applications | Wood & Light Metal Cutting |
